Research TopicNew Urbanism in Architecture BackgroundUrban planning has been around since centuries ago. The meaning of urban planning in simple words means improvement. Urban plan has been improved in every stage of generation. Urban planning is also the technical process with the control use of land and design of the urban environment. These urban environment include transportation, networks, building and surroundings. The urban plan itself is a research and analysis workload. Landscape EnvironmentLand is being used for residential or industrialPlans which area is suitable for future development, needs to be conservedHelps the community establish zoning codesLand use regulations to guide future development

Urban planning and designContext - Seeing that buildings, places and spaces are part of the whole town or cityCharacter - Reflecting and enhancing the distinctive character, heritage and identity of our urban environmentChoice - Ensuring diversity and choice for peopleConnections - Enhancing how different networks link together for peopleCustodianship - Ensuring design is environmentally sustainable, safe and healthy

Urban Planning Issues- Better planning of land use- Increasing biodiversity and green space- Reducing environmental risks
